microsoft / PowerShell-DSC-for-Linux

PowerShell Desired State Configuration - for Linux
Other
339 stars 132 forks source link

dsc_host *still* changing configuration files permissions #622

Open johanburati opened 5 years ago

johanburati commented 5 years ago

I have already reported an issue with dsc_host changing configuration files permissions (https://github.com/microsoft/PowerShell-DSC-for-Linux/issues/589), a patch was created by @zjalali and merged (https://github.com/microsoft/PowerShell-DSC-for-Linux/pull/605) and the issue was closed.

However the issue still occur with OmsAgentForLinux-1.11.15 , as you can see bwlow the permissions change at random:

# 1568959190 
-rw-r--r--. 1 omsagent omiusers  153 Sep 20 05:45 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-r--r--. 1 omsagent omiusers 1416 Sep 20 05:45 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-r--r--. 1 omsagent omiusers 1417 Sep 20 05:45 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959191
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959192
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959193
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959194
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959195
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959196
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959197
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959198
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959199
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959200
-rw-rw-rw-. 1 omsagent omiusers  154 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-rw-rw-. 1 omsagent omiusers 1416 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-rw-rw-. 1 omsagent omiusers 1417 Sep 20 05:59 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of
# 1568959201
-rw-r--r--. 1 omsagent omiusers  154 Sep 20 06:00 /etc/opt/omi/conf/omsconfig/configuration/DSCEngineCache.mof
-rw-r--r--. 1 omsagent omiusers 1417 Sep 20 06:00 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.backup.mof
-rw-r--r--. 1 omsagent omiusers 1416 Sep 20 06:00 /etc/opt/omi/conf/omsconfig/configuration/MetaConfig.mof

Could you tell us when you plan to release a version of the OmsAgentForLinux extension with a fix for this issue ?

johanburati commented 5 years ago

I could find the answer, the patch should be included in the next release.

johanburati commented 5 years ago

Could you tell me when a new version of the extension with the patch (#605) will be pushed ?